The Rapid Structural Drying Process: What to Expect
When you call our team, you can expect a thorough and efficient process that gets your home dry and safe in no time. Our process typically takes 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. We’ll work closely with you to ensure a smooth and stress-free experience.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technicians will arrive at your property within 60 minutes to assess the damage and create a customized plan to dry and restore your home. We’ll use our thermal imaging cameras to detect hidden moisture and hydrometers to measure the water levels. This ensures we get it right the first time and save you time and money.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
Using our industrial-grade pumps and high-velocity air movers we’ll extract the water and start the drying process. Our team will work tirelessly to ensure your home is dry and safe, using desiccants and dehumidifiers to speed up the process.
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Once the drying process is complete, our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ize your home to prevent mold and bacteria growth. We’ll use eco-friendly cleaning products and HEPA filters to ensure a healthy environment for you and your family.
Step 4: Restoration and Repairs
Finally, our team will work with you to restore your home to its original condition. This may include drywall repair painting and flooring installation. We’ll ensure your home is safe, secure, and looks better than ever.

Rapid Structural Drying v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ill in a contained area | Yes | No | Easy to clean and dry with household equipment |
| Water damage in a large area or with structural damage |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age |
| Hidden moisture behind walls or under flooring |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and training to detect and address |
| Water damage with mold growth | No | Yes | Needs professional equipment and expertise to safely remove mold and prevent re-growth |
| Water damage with electrical issues | No | Yes | Needs professional expertise to safely address electrical issues and prevent further damage |

Rapid Structural Drying Cost in Monrovia, CA
The cost of Rapid Structural Drying varies dep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ates typically range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the scope of the job. Get a free estimate today and let us help you find out the best course of action for your home.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$1,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Structural drying and repair | $1,000 – $3,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Water damage assessment and planning | $200 – $500 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|
| Dehumidification and drying equipment rental | $100 – $300 | Size of affected area and duration of rental |
| Sanitizing and cleaning services | $200 – $500 | Size of affected area and type of cleaning products used |
